Everything You Should Know Before Moving to Fackler, AL

Considering a move to Fackler, AL? This quiet rural community of about 450 residents boasts affordable housing, with median home prices around $110,000 and average rent near $730. The cost of living is well below national averages, and you'll enjoy a moderate climate with 60% sunny days. Commute times average about 27 minutes, and families benefit from access to local public schools and nearby healthcare in Scottsboro. While crime rates are higher than some rural areas, Fackler offers a peaceful lifestyle and the charm of small-town Alabama living.

Is Fackler, AL a safe place to live?

While Fackler is a quiet town, its crime rate is higher than some rural areas, with a 1 in 258 chance of violent crime and a 1 in 48 chance of property crime. Residents should take standard safety precautions but can still enjoy a generally peaceful atmosphere.

What is the weather like in Fackler, AL year-round?

Residents experience a mild climate, with winters averaging lows of 31°F and summers reaching highs near 89°F. The area receives about 54 inches of rainfall annually and enjoys approximately 60% sunny days, allowing for plenty of outdoor activities year-round.
